Transaction 39348bb1e0892b4f1879766c656d27c86daceb7d9d2b4e242b28463e8233e021
1 Input
1 Output
-
39348bb1e0892b4f1879766c656d27c86daceb7d9d2b4e242b28463e8233e021:0
- value
- 1576334
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d70a59e30bb1148c790bbc6778e3e9e93e23f037 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Lc2gTDaSyjTiJAW5wFi1KZLnuUAcFGW3U